Boil the brine. Combine vinegar, water, and canning salt in a large pot and bring it to a boil while you pack the jars with the brussels sprouts. Pack the jars. Pack brussels sprouts into jars, top with a garlic clove, some diced onion, some diced jalapeno, mustard seed, and peppercorns. Add the brine.

White vinegar and water - You can use cider vinegar or a mix of vinegars. Note that cider vinegar will give you a tint of amber color. Kosher salt Peppercorns Mustard seeds Bay leaves Garlic cloves - the fresher the better! Red Pepper flakes - double up the amount if you like an extra heat. The amount in the recipe adds flavor, not heat.
